02 480 SU22- Intro to Managerial Carmelita Inc., has the following information available: Costs from Costs from Cengage NOWv2 | Online teaching and learning resource from Cengage Learning Direct materials Conversion costs Beginning Inventory Current Period $5,900 5,200 $27,300 151,200 At the beginning of the period, there were 500 units in process that were 45% complete as to conversion costs and 100% complete as to direct materials costs. During the period, 5,400 units were started and completed. Ending inventory contained 400 units that were 27% complete as to conversion costs and 100% complete as to materials costs. Assume that the company uses the FIFO process cost method. Round cost per unit figures to two cents, ie, $2.22, when calculating total costs. The total costs that will be transferred into Finished Goods for units started and completed were a. $166,590 b. $121,611 c. $178,930 d. $227,241 Previous Next >
